The Ultimate Guide to Parrot Care: Keeping Your Feathered Friend Happy and Healthy
Parrots are amongst the most intelligent and colorful animals anybody can own. With their striking plumage, spirited antics, and amazing ability to simulate human speech, they have actually won the hearts of pet lovers worldwide. Nevertheless, looking after a parrot needs a dedication to meeting their physical, emotional, and social needs. In this guide, we will explore necessary aspects of parrot care, consisting of diet plan, habitat, and health.

Parrots include a wide variety of species, each with unique attributes and requirements. Here's a brief summary of some common types:
SpeciesTypical SizeLifespanSocial NeedsBudgerigar (Budgie)7 inches5-10 yearsModerateCockatiel12-14 inches10-15 yearsHighAfrican Grey12-14 inches40-60 yearsReally HighAmazon10-20 inches25-50 yearsHighMacaw20-40 inches30-50 yearsExtremely High
Choosing the right types is essential for compatibility with your lifestyle and capability to offer the requisite care.
2. Establishing the Perfect Habitat
Parrots require an environment that imitates their natural environment as carefully as possible. Here are crucial elements to think about:
Cage Size: The cage should be large enough for the parrot to spread its wings fully. For bigger types like macaws, an expansive cage is needed.Perches: Graupapagei Kaufen Provide numerous perches made from various products (wood, rope, etc) to promote foot health.Toys: Parrots are smart and require mental stimulation. Offer a range of toys for chewing, climbing, and foraging.Area: Place the cage in a part of your house where the parrot can connect with relative however feels secure.

Diet plan and Nutrition for Parrots
A well balanced diet plan is essential to a parrot's health. Parrots require a mix of pellets, Graupapagei Zucht seeds, fruits, and vegetables.
Key Components of a Parrot's Diet:Pellets: Formulated pellets should comprise about 50-70% of their diet.Seeds: Offer seeds as a reward instead of the staple diet because they are high in fat.Vegetables and fruits: Fresh fruits (like apples, berries) and vegetables (like carrots, leafy greens) are essential for vitamins and Wo Man Graupapageien Kaufen Kann minerals.Nuts: In small amounts, unsalted nuts can be a helpful protein source.Food TypeRecommended Amount dailyNotesPellets1-2 tablespoonsHigh-quality brandsSeeds1 teaspoonUsage as deals withFruits1 tablespoonWash and Ernährung Von Graupapageien cut freshVeggies1-2 tablespoonsRange is crucialNuts1-2 per dayNo salted varieties4. Socializing and Mental Stimulation
Parrots are extremely social animals that grow on interaction. Lack of socializing can lead to behavioral issues. Below are methods to ensure your parrot stays mentally stimulated:
Interaction: Spend time talking, playing, and managing your parrot daily. Training: Teaching your parrot tricks and commands can be rewarding for both the owner and the bird.Playtime Outside the Cage: Create a bird-safe location where your parrot can check out and play.Foraging Activities: Hide deals with in toys or paper, motivating the parrot to work for its benefits.Recommended Activities:ActivityDescriptionDaily PlaytimeAt least 1-2 hours outside the cageTraining Sessions5-10 minutes, numerous times a weekInteractive ToysPuzzle toys to promote foragingSocial InteractionsScheduling playdates with other birds5. Common Health Issues
Awareness of potential illness is essential for any parrot owner. Here are some typical conditions:
Health IssueSymptomsAvoidance TipsFeather PluckingBald spots, extreme scratchingEnrichment, appropriate dietBreathing ProblemsCoughing, wheezingPreserve tidy environment, avoid draftsWeight problemsOverweight appearance, sleepinessBalanced diet plan, regular exerciseBeak and Papagei kaufen Deutschland Nail IssuesOvergrown beak/nailsProvide tough perches, routine vet visits
Regular veterinary check-ups are essential to capture and deal with any concerns early.
6. FAQs
Q: How typically should I take my parrot to the vet?A: A yearly check-up is suggested, but consult your veterinarian for specific requirements. Q: Can parrots eat avocado?A: No, avocados

are hazardous to parrots and need to be avoided.
Q: Do parrots need to bathe?A: Yes, regular bathing is necessary for feather care.Offer a shallow meal of water or mist them
with water. Q: How can I inform if my parrot is happy?A: Happy parrots exhibit lively habits, vocalize a lot, and have a bright, alertdemeanor. 7.
